What is a Private Psychiatrist?
A private psychiatrist is a qualified medical doctor who specializes in detecting, treating, and avoiding mental health conditions. They have actually undergone extensive training in psychiatry and hold a license to practice medicine. Unlike public mental health services, private psychiatrists use instant access to their services, often with much shorter waiting times. Here are some crucial functions of a private psychiatrist:

The cost of consulting a private psychiatrist in the UK can vary commonly, depending upon numerous factors, including the psychiatrist's experience, the place of their practice, and the particular services required. Normally, initial evaluations might vary from ₤ 150 to ₤ 500, while follow-up assessments can cost in between ₤ 100 and ₤ 350. Many private psychiatrists charge on a per-session basis, however some might use package for ongoing treatment.
Typical Costs OverviewServiceTypical Cost (GBP)Initial Consultation₤ 150 - ₤ 500Follow-Up Consultation₤ 100 - ₤ 350Psychiatric therapy Sessions₤ 50 - ₤ 150 per sessionMedication ManagementConsisted of in assessment charge
It is also necessary to consider that some private treatment strategies might not be covered by insurance, so it is suggested to talk to your insurance coverage supplier before seeking private care.

What certifications should a private psychiatrist have?
Private psychiatrists ought to hold a medical degree, complete specialized training in psychiatry, and be registered with the General Medical Council (GMC).
2. The length of time does a common consultation last?
An initial consultation usually lasts in between 60 to 90 minutes, while follow-up consultations may take around 30 to 60 minutes.
3. Can private psychiatrists recommend medication?
Yes, private psychiatrists are licensed medical doctors and can recommend medications as part of the treatment strategy.
4. Is private psychiatric treatment covered by insurance?
This depends upon the insurance supplier and the particular policy. It's suggested to inspect with the insurance provider in advance.
5. What should I expect during my very first consultation?
During the very first appointment, the psychiatrist will perform an assessment, discuss your concerns, and summary possible treatment choices.
